DXG USA DXG-A85V HD DXG Pro Gear 1080p High-Definition Camcorder
Looking for a high-definition camcorder you can take on your next safari or simply your next vacation in New York City? The DXG-A85V HD provides you with a lot of advanced features but without the price to match. With a 10MP sensor and 12X optical zoom, the DXG-A85V HD will capture life in great detail, even at 200 feet away. This compact and rugged camcorder records full 1080p at 60fps, features high-speed sequential shot mode and a dual-capture mode that allows you to record video and take picture at the same time. And with 720p at 60fps, the DXG-A85V HD is perfect for sports and other action shots. Even cooler is the 3.0" touch screen display and an HDMI output to easily connect to your HDTV.
